Building and Construction Industry Training Organisation Incorporated
The Board of Skill New Zealand – Pūkenga Aotearoa, pursuant to section 5 of the Industry Training Act 1992 and having consulted with the New Zealand Qualifications Authority, afforded recognition to the Building and Construction Industry Training Organisation Incorporated to set standards at Levels 1 to 8 on the National Qualifications Framework for the building and construction, fibrous plastering, solid plastering, tiling, and cement and concrete industries for a further period of five years with effect from 5 January 2003.
Dated at Wellington this 16th day of December 2002.
ADRIENNE D’ATH, Chairperson.

Plastics Industry Training Organisation Incorporated
The Board of Skill New Zealand – Pūkenga Aotearoa, hereby gives notice that on 31 October 2002, it recognised that the Plastics Industry Training Organisation Incorporated has formally changed its name to the Plastics and Materials Processing Industry Training Organisation, and that the gazetted coverage for the industry training organisation remains the plastics industry, with effect from 31 October 2002.
Dated at Wellington this 16th day of December 2002.
ADRIENNE D’ATH, Chairperson.

Social Development
Social Security Act 1964
Defence Force Allowance Amendment 2002/2
Pursuant to section 124 (1) (d) of the Social Security Act 1964, the Minister of Social Services and Employment establishes and approves the following Amendment to the Defence Force Allowance Programme (as established and approved on 29 October 1999).
Dated at Wellington this 19th day of December 2002.
STEVE MAHAREY, Minister of Social Services and Employment.
Amendment
-
Title—(1) This is the Defence Force Allowance Amendment 2002/2.
(2) In this amendment, the Defence Force Allowance Programme is called “the programme”.
-
Commencement—This amendment comes into effect on the day after the date on which it is approved by the Minister.
-
Schedule amended—The Schedule of the programme is amended by adding the following paragraphs:
